首先,__Name__是系统变量,存放什么值由系统定义
当前文件被执行时,__name__存放值为__main__
当前文件被import时,__name__存放的是模块名(即去掉.py后缀的文件名)
本文详细介绍了Python中特殊变量__name__的作用及其应用场景。当脚本作为主程序运行时,__name__的值为'__main__';而当脚本被其他程序导入时,__name__则为该脚本的文件名(不包含.py后缀)。掌握这一特性有助于开发者更好地组织代码结构。
首先,__Name__是系统变量,存放什么值由系统定义
当前文件被执行时,__name__存放值为__main__
当前文件被import时,__name__存放的是模块名(即去掉.py后缀的文件名)

被折叠的 条评论
为什么被折叠?